Africa-Press – Nigeria. Candidate of the Labour Party, LP, in the 2024 Edo State governorship election, Olumide Akpata, has denied claims that he is planning to defect the All Progressives Congress, APC.

There were reports that Akpata was set to defect to the APC.

However, Akpata has described the reports as mischievous and false.

In a post on X, he wrote, “In the past 24 hours, a malicious, mischievous and utterly false rumour has been concocted in the dark alleys of social media, and unfortunately amplified by mischief-makers, alleging that I have abandoned the @NgLabour Party, the very platform on which I contested the 2024 Edo State gubernatorial election, to join the All Progressives Congress, APC.

“This is not only false but laughable. I state without equivocation that I have neither contemplated, discussed, nor effected a defection to the APC and for the avoidance of doubt, I have no intention of ever joining the APC.”

Akpata contested the Edo State governorship election on the platform of the Labour Party. He however lost to APC candidate, Governor Monday Okpebholo.
